The first stage for JEE Main preparation should be to know the syllabus and exam pattern for the entrance test. Firstly, thoroughly through the JEE Mains 2026 syllabus. Then, look at the latest exam pattern table given below:
| Subject | Type of Questions | Marks |
|---|---|---|
| Physics | 20 MCQs + 5 Numerical (NAT) | 100 |
| Chemistry | 20 MCQs + 5 Numerical (NAT) | 100 |
| Mathematics | 20 MCQs + 5 Numerical (NAT) | 100 |
| Total | 300 |
To know how to crack JEE Main 2026, students should primarily check the important JEE Main books. Check the list of important books with author names for JEE Main 2026 below.
Concepts of Physics Vol I and II by H.C. Verma
Problems in General Physics by I.E. Irodov
Fundamentals of Physics by Halliday, Resnick & Walker
Numerical Chemistry by P. Bahadur
Organic Chemistry by Paula Bruice Yurkanis
Inorganic Chemistry by J.D. Lee
Organic Chemistry by Morrison & Boyd
Maths XI & XII by NCERT
Trigonometry by S. L. Loney
Coordinate Geometry by S. L. Loney
Higher Algebra by Hall & Knight
Problems in Calculus of One Variable by I.A. Maron
Referring to the chapter-wise weightage for preparation is a great source for prioritizing important chapters. Since the days are limited, candidates must pay extra attention to the chapters with high weightage. You can download the JEE Main Chapter-Wise Weightage and practice each chapter according to your plan. After studying each chapter, you can solve the JEE Main Chapter-Wise PYQs before moving on to the next chapter.
Candidates wishing to crack JEE Main must practice at least the last 10 years of JEE Main question paper with solution. This helps them gain confidence in solving the questions that come in the test, while at the same time, they learn the route to solve questions in different ways. Well practice and more practice is a sure-shot successful method for how to crack JEE Main.
While we talk about JEE Main 2026 preparation, candidates must ask themselves a question: will they be able to cover every subject (Physics, Chemistry, and Maths) and every topic twice or thrice as they keep on approaching the exam? The retaining capacity is not much for many average students. So, experts advise making short notes to recall formulas and to symbolize tough topics that come into play. If you do not leave time for revision and are just thinking of directly appearing for the test, then you are mistaken. Candidates need to freshen up the topics, concepts, and units they studied months ago once they come closer to the actual exam. So you must make a plan for JEE Main preparation that keeps an ample amount of time for revision. This is where your short notes will help you in quickly glancing through whatever you manage to study till that time. It must be noted that JEE Main 2026 preparation must not be without any revision. Revision is a must to crack JEE Main. Along with revision students must also practice mock tests and sample papers regularly to check if their preparation is going in the right direction or not.
